I've been eyeing portable projectors for a while now, and the Magcubic Projector caught my attention with its impressive specs and compact design. This mini projector promises to deliver high-quality visuals, seamless connectivity, and a built-in app ecosystem, all within a device that's small enough to carry in a backpack.
One of the standout features of this projector is its built-in apps. You get access to a vast library of 1,000,000 videos, which is a game-changer for casual movie nights or family gatherings. No need to lug around an external TV stick or worry about complicated setup – just fire up the projector and start streaming. The interface is user-friendly, and the projector's WiFi 6 and Bluetooth 5.4 capabilities ensure lag-free streaming from your phone, laptop, or console.
Brightness and Image Quality
The Magcubic Projector boasts 200 ANSI lumens and an 8000:1 contrast ratio, making it suitable for casual movie watching or kids' shows. The native 720p resolution with 4K support is a nice touch, especially considering the price point. It's not meant to replace a high-end home theater projector, but for a compact, portable option, it's a great compromise. Most people will appreciate the image quality, especially in a dimly lit room or for outdoor movie nights.
Connectivity and Portability
The projector's compact design and 180-degree rotating stand make it easy to set up anywhere. You get HDMI and USB ports for instant setup, and the ultra-compact design means you can toss it in a backpack for grab-and-go entertainment. The universal connectivity options, including WiFi and Bluetooth, make it easy to stream content from your devices.
A common reaction to this projector is that it's a great option for short trips or outdoor gatherings. The built-in battery life isn't specified, but the projector's low power consumption means you can get a few hours of use on a single charge.
Limitations and Drawbacks
Not a big deal, but it's worth noting that the projector's image quality may not hold up in very bright environments. If you're planning to use it for outdoor daytime events, you might want to consider a different option. Additionally, the projector's built-in speakers are decent but not exceptional – if you're an audiophile, you might want to invest in a separate sound system.
This projector might not be the best fit for serious home theater enthusiasts or those who need a high-end cinematic experience. However, for casual users who want a reliable, portable projector for everyday entertainment, the Magcubic Projector is a great option.
